电子表格拼音姓名怎么自动生成(拼音)

电子表格拼音姓名怎么自动生成

在日常办公或数据处理中,经常需要将中文姓名转换为对应的拼音,比如用于制作英文名片、系统账号、国际交流资料等。手动逐个输入不仅效率低下,还容易出错。幸运的是,借助电子表格软件(如 Microsoft Excel 或 WPS 表格),我们可以利用函数、插件或内置功能快速实现拼音姓名的自动生成。

使用 Excel 插件或加载项

对于 Excel 用户来说,最便捷的方式之一是安装专门的拼音插件。例如,“Excel 拼音助手”或“方方格子”等第三方加载项,能够一键将中文姓名转为带声调或不带声调的拼音。这类插件通常提供菜单按钮,选中姓名列后点击即可批量生成拼音,操作简单且准确率高。需要注意的是,部分插件可能需要联网或付费使用,适合对效率要求较高的办公场景。

利用 WPS 表格的内置功能

如果你使用的是国产办公软件 WPS 表格,恭喜你——它本身就内置了“中文转拼音”功能。只需选中包含中文姓名的单元格区域,点击顶部菜单栏的“公式”→“中文转拼音”,系统便会自动在相邻列生成对应拼音。该功能支持是否显示声调、是否分隔姓与名等选项,非常实用。对于大多数国内用户而言,这是最省事、无需额外安装工具的解决方案。

通过 VBA 自定义函数实现

对于熟悉编程的用户,还可以通过编写 VBA(Visual Basic for Applications)宏来自定义拼音转换函数。虽然这种方法有一定技术门槛,但一旦设置完成,就可以在任意工作簿中重复使用。网上有许多开源的 VBA 拼音转换代码,只需将其粘贴到 Excel 的 VBA 编辑器中,像普通函数一样调用即可。例如,输入 =GetPY(A2) 即可返回 A2 单元格中姓名的拼音首字母或全拼。

注意事项与常见问题

无论采用哪种方法,都需注意几个细节:一是多音字问题,例如“重”“行”等字在不同语境下发音不同,自动转换可能出错;二是生僻字或非标准汉字可能无法识别;三是部分方法仅支持简体中文。因此,在批量生成拼音后,建议人工抽查关键数据,尤其是涉及正式文件或对外沟通的场合。如果数据量极大,可考虑结合 Python 等脚本语言进行预处理,再导入电子表格。

写在最后

电子表格中自动生成拼音姓名并非难事,关键在于选择适合自己使用习惯和软件环境的方法。WPS 用户可直接使用内置功能,Excel 用户则可借助插件或 VBA 实现。掌握这些技巧,不仅能大幅提升工作效率,还能减少人为错误,让数据处理更加专业、规范。随着办公自动化程度的提高,这类小技巧正逐渐成为职场人士的必备技能之一。

本文经用户投稿或网站收集转载,如有侵权请联系本站。

发表评论

0条回复